Wood has an exciting opportunity for a Reward Manager to join our Reward & Mobility team to manage the delivery of projects, frameworks, programs, standards and improvements, across the Asia Pacific, Middle East, Africa & Caspian, and UK & Europe regions to support our long-term strategic delivery. Reporting to the Vice President of Total Reward the position will influence and contribute to the formation of strategy, policy design and organisation wide frameworks ensuring alignment with regional priorities and total reward approach.

This position can be either hybrid from any of our UK offices, or remote

The role

The Reward Manager’s objective is to ensure the reward practices attract, retain, and motivate employees at Wood while adhering to legal and regulatory requirements. You will ensure effective business partnering as well as developing knowledge and understanding among leaders, HR teams and employees where you will provide valuable insights and recommendations to guide decision-making.

You will proactively contribute to the global reward strategy to align with business requirements, legislation, and market trends. The goal is to ensure the strategy is both internally fair and externally competitive. You should understand external market practices, emerging trends, and legislative changes.

The role is responsible for leading and delivering reward strategies across UK & Europe, Middle East, Africa & Caspian, and Asia-Pacific regions (EMEA and APAC). Partnering closely with HR, Finance, and business leaders, the role ensures compensation and benefits programs are market-competitive, compliant with local regulations, and aligned with the company’s global reward framework. This position plays a critical part in regional reward governance and operations, including pay transparency readiness, pay equity compliance, and data-driven decision-making. It supports the ongoing evolution of compensation programs and leads annual benefits renewals, as well as other cyclical programs such as the annual salary review process. This role also manages key vendor relationships, monitors program outcomes, and recommends improvements as needed.

Additionally, you will be responsible for identifying and addressing potential risks in the organisation’s reward practices and guiding the development of reward initiatives that align with business needs, leveraging the employee value proposition and reward levers to meet strategic objectives.

Ensuring that employee engagement is prioritised through transparent communication and collaboration with various stakeholders across HR, finance, and leadership teams and emphasise fostering a culture of innovation, continuous improvement, and change.
